DDR3-SDRAM-Kompatibilität: Taktfrequenz und Timings
Ich möchte das DDR3-SDRAM meines Computers aufrüsten und das derzeitige Einzelmodul durch neuere ersetzen. Ich frage mich, ob ich mich strikt an die vom Hersteller des Computers angegebene Version DDR3-1333 halten muss (oder muss) oder ob ich einfach ein (oder einiges) schnellere (aber ansonsten kompatible) Module verwenden kann.
Nachdem ich ein wenig über das Thema gelesen und festgestellt hatte, dass ich völlig durcheinander bin, hier ein paar Fragen (ich hoffe, dass sie kohärent sind):
Apropos Default-Werte (vor einem möglichen Benutzer-Tweak), die tatsächliche Taktfrequenz und die Speicherzeiten werden vom Controller automatisch und optimal eingestellt (irgendwie werden die Funktionen von den Modulen gelesen) oder sie verwenden eine feste Konfiguration (in der Firmware fest codiert). muss das bei der Installation von Modulen übereinstimmen?
Was passiert bei einem Motherboard, das einen bestimmten SDRAM-Takt benötigt, wenn ich ein ansonsten kompatibles Modul mit einer höheren Standardgeschwindigkeit (dh bis zu DDR3-2133 / PC3-17000) verwende? Mögliche Gründe (möglicherweise die meisten oder alle falsch), warum dies möglicherweise nicht funktioniert, umfassen zum Beispiel:
2.1. Es funktioniert nicht, wenn der Controller die höhere Geschwindigkeit des Moduls nicht unterstützt. Schließlich kann nicht garantiert werden, dass ein DDR3-SDRAM-Controller alle Geschwindigkeiten im JESD79-Standard unterstützt.
2.2. Es funktioniert nicht, wenn das System die Taktfrequenz und / oder die Zeiteinstellungen nicht manuell anpassen kann, da dies nicht automatisch geschieht.
2.3. Es funktioniert nicht, wenn der Controller keine Timings unterstützt, die der Latenzzeit des Moduls entsprechen (angepasst an die reduzierte Taktrate): Die Daten stehen auf den Ausgangspins des Moduls nicht lange genug zur Verfügung.
2.4. Es funktioniert nicht, wenn das Modul die maximale Geschwindigkeit der Steuerung nicht unterstützt. Schließlich kann nicht garantiert werden, dass ein DDR3-SDRAM-Modul alle niedrigeren Geschwindigkeiten im JESD79-Standard unterstützt.
2,5. Es funktioniert nicht, wenn das Modul keine Timings unterstützt, die mit der maximalen Geschwindigkeit des Controllers kompatibel sind (dh für die reduzierte Geschwindigkeit angepasst).
2.6. Usw.
Wenn es funktionieren könnte, was wären dann neben einem möglicherweise höheren Preis für die Module die Nachteile oder Fallstricke einer solchen Konfiguration? Ein möglicher Grund könnte sein:
3.1. Der Controller passt die Timings nicht unter Berücksichtigung der reduzierten Taktrate an. Stattdessen werden nur die vom Speichermodul angegebenen Zeiten für die maximale Taktrate verwendet, was zu einer geringeren Leistung führt (als dies mit einem niedrigeren Geschwindigkeits-, aber einem niedrigeren CL-Modul möglich wäre). Wenn Sie beispielsweise einen 11-11-11 DDR3-2133 mit 1333 Geschwindigkeit verwenden, verwendet der Controller 11-11-11 anstelle von 7-7-7.
3.2. Usw.
Kurz gesagt, ich würde wirklich gerne die Gründe verstehen, warum dies funktionieren würde / würde oder nicht funktionieren würde. Ich bin mir jedoch ziemlich sicher, dass ich den Standard selbst nicht lesen konnte.
Vielen Dank!
0 Antworten auf die Frage
Verwandte Probleme
-
6
Muss ich 3 RAM-DIMMs haben, um DDR3 verwenden zu können, oder sogar eine 3-Kanal-CPU betreiben könne...
-
5
Warum läuft mein CPU-Fan, wenn Sie Videos oder virtuelle Maschinen ausführen?
-
4
Gibt es einen bestimmten oder messbaren Vorteil bei der Verwendung von ECC-RAM in einem Desktop-PC?
-
2
iTunes-Speicherverwendung
-
5
So ermitteln Sie, welche Firefox-Add-Ons den meisten Speicher verwenden
-
5
Was soll ich mit meinem alten Gedächtnis machen?
-
3
Wie kann ich feststellen, ob der Arbeitsspeicher auf meinem ASUS P5B MX-Motherboard von 2 auf 4 GB e...
-
6
Warum ist RAM für die neuen Macbooks so teuer?
-
8
"Speicher paarweise installieren" Wie funktioniert das für 3 GB?
-
7
Wohin sind die anderen 0,8 GB RAM gegangen?